Psalm 119 is full of good things to ponder on and encourage us in. I share this portion of it today. 

Thou art my portion, O LORD: I have said that I would keep thy words. 

I intreated thy favour with my whole heart: be merciful unto me according to thy word. 

I thought on my ways, and turned my feet unto thy testimonies. 

I made haste, and delayed not to keep thy commandments. 

The bands of the wicked have robbed me: but I have not forgotten thy law. 

At midnight I will rise to give thanks unto thee because of thy righteous judgments. 

I am a companion of all them that fear thee, and of them that keep thy precepts. 

The earth, O LORD, is full of thy mercy: teach me thy statutes. 

Thou hast dealt well with thy servant, O LORD, according unto thy word. 

Teach me good judgment and knowledge: for I have believed thy commandments. 

Before I was afflicted I went astray: but now have I kept thy word. 

Thou art good, and doest good; teach me thy statutes. 

The proud have forged a lie against me: but I will keep thy precepts with my whole heart. 

Their heart is as fat as grease; but I delight in thy law. 

It is good for me that I have been afflicted; that I might learn thy statutes. 

The law of thy mouth is better unto me than thousands of gold and silver.

Psalm 119:57-72
